On Wednesday P3/4 and S1 were picking up bruck around the school. We found lots of rubbish because we looked everywhere in the garden. Lots of rubbish was stuck behind things and in bushes! We have learned that the wind can blow rubbish into the bushes and animal homes and that’s why we dunna chuck bruck. We enjoyed it but we hope to find less rubbish next year!
